Category: Software-Devalopment

  • Internet of Things (IoT) Development

    The Internet of Things (IoT) has revolutionized the way we interact with technology by connecting physical objects to the digital realm. IoT development involves creating intelligent systems that enable devices to collect, exchange, and analyze data to make informed decisions and automate processes. From smart homes and wearable devices to industrial automation and smart cities,…

  • Data Analytics and Visualization

    In today’s data-driven world, organizations are inundated with vast amounts of data. However, raw data alone does not provide value. To extract meaningful insights and make informed decisions, businesses rely on data analytics and visualization. Data analytics involves examining, transforming, and modeling data to uncover patterns, correlations, and trends. Visualization, on the other hand, transforms…

  • Security and Encryption

    In today’s interconnected digital world, security and encryption have become paramount for protecting sensitive information and ensuring privacy. With cyber threats on the rise, organizations, and individuals must implement robust security measures to safeguard data from unauthorized access, breaches, and cyberattacks. In this article, we will explore the importance of security and encryption, their key…

  • Project Management and Collaboration

    Project management and collaboration are integral to the success of any project, whether it’s a small team endeavor or a large-scale organizational initiative. Effective project management ensures that projects are completed on time, within budget, and meet the desired goals and objectives. Collaboration, on the other hand, fosters teamwork, knowledge sharing, and innovation. In this…

  • User Interface and User Experience (UI/UX) Design

    User Interface (UI) and User Experience (UX) design play a pivotal role in creating intuitive and engaging digital experiences for users. UI focuses on the visual elements and interactive components that users interact with, while UX focuses on the overall user journey, usability, and emotional connection. In this article, we will explore the importance of…

  • Cloud Computing and Deployment

    Cloud computing has revolutionized the way businesses and individuals access and manage their computing resources. By leveraging the power of the cloud, organizations can benefit from scalable infrastructure, on-demand services, and flexible deployment options. In this article, we will explore the concept of cloud computing, its advantages, deployment models, and the impact it has on…

  • Artificial Intelligence and Machine Learning

    Artificial Intelligence (AI) and Machine Learning (ML) have revolutionized various industries, paving the way for intelligent systems that can learn, reason, and make decisions. AI and ML technologies enable computers to mimic human intelligence, analyze massive amounts of data, and extract valuable insights. In this article, we will delve into the world of AI and…

  • Testing and Quality Assurance

    In the world of software development, testing and quality assurance (QA) are vital components of the development lifecycle. Testing ensures that software meets functional and non-functional requirements, while QA focuses on establishing and maintaining quality standards throughout the development process. In this article, we will explore the importance of testing and QA, their key principles,…

  • Version Control Systems

    In the world of software development, version control systems (VCS) have become indispensable tools for managing code, enabling collaboration, and facilitating efficient development workflows. Version control systems provide a centralized repository for tracking changes to code over time, allowing teams to work together seamlessly and manage codebase evolution effectively. In this article, we will explore…

  • DevOps and Continuous Integration

    In the fast-paced world of software development, DevOps and Continuous Integration (CI) have emerged as game-changing practices that foster collaboration, efficiency, and the rapid delivery of high-quality software. DevOps bridges the gap between development and operations, promoting seamless collaboration and automation, while Continuous Integration ensures that code changes are integrated, tested, and deployed continuously. In…

  • Game Development

    Game development is a captivating blend of art, design, and technology that transports players into interactive and immersive digital worlds. From mobile games to console blockbusters, the game development industry has evolved into a thriving ecosystem, captivating millions of players worldwide. In this article, we will delve into the exciting realm of game development, exploring…

  • Programming Languages and Tools

    In the realm of software development, programming languages and tools play a vital role in enabling developers to create innovative and efficient applications. These languages act as a bridge between human logic and machine execution, while the tools provide essential support and enhancements to streamline the development process. In this article, we will delve into…